Editorial Notes

For a Workforce Analyst, a resume must immediately convey an aptitude for data-driven insights and strategic HR impact. Hiring managers seek candidates who can translate complex HR data into actionable strategies that optimize organizational performance and reduce costs. Key achievements often include quantifiable improvements in workforce planning, recruitment efficiency, and retention. Specific terminology like predictive modeling, dashboard development, and HRIS expertise (e.g., Workday, SAP SuccessFactors) are crucial. Certifications such as SHRM-CP and specialized workforce planning credentials are also highly regarded, demonstrating a commitment to both HR principles and analytical rigor.

Workforce Analyst salary by country

Country25th percentileMedian75th percentile
US$66,800$81,176$106,000
UK£31,243£39,036£53,411
CanadaC$50,124C$69,634C$96,658
AustraliaA$196,750A$253,500A$310,250
Germany€37,813€46,818€59,079
France€35,132€43,250€52,813
Netherlands€42,622€52,145€62,699
Italy€22,000€33,750€42,857
Austria€35,833€50,000€64,167
New ZealandNZ$106,250NZ$125,000NZ$162,500
India₹312,399₹624,799₹937,198
Polandzł116,667zł171,429zł188,235

Annual salaries in local currency, aggregated from live job postings via Adzuna. Figures refresh continuously and reflect advertised pay, not negotiated offers.

Frequently Asked Questions

What's the best resume structure for a mid-level Workforce Analyst?
A chronological resume is ideal for a mid-level Workforce Analyst, emphasizing your progressive experience in data analysis and workforce planning. Start with a compelling professional summary that highlights your analytical skills and ability to drive strategic HR decisions. Clearly present your technical proficiencies and specific project contributions.
Which key skills should I highlight as a Workforce Analyst with 3-7 years of experience?
Emphasize your proficiency in data analytics tools such as Excel, SQL, Tableau, Power BI, or HRIS systems like Workday or SAP. Highlight skills in workforce planning, forecasting, predictive analytics, and HR metrics. Include strong analytical reasoning, problem-solving, and communication skills, particularly in translating data into actionable insights.
How do I write strong achievement bullets for my Workforce Analyst resume?
Quantify your impact by showcasing how your analysis led to tangible business improvements. For example, "Developed a staffing model that reduced overtime costs by 15% across three departments." Your professional summary should concisely communicate your ability to leverage data for strategic workforce decision-making and business optimization.
What optional sections should I include on my Workforce Analyst resume?
A "Technical Skills" section detailing your proficiency in various software, programming languages, and HRIS systems is highly important. Consider a "Projects" section if you've led significant analytical initiatives or developed custom dashboards. Any relevant certifications in analytics, HR, or specific software platforms should also be listed.
